Digging Deep into the App Settings
First, let's dive into the app. Find that little menu icon. You know, the one that looks like three lines stacked on each other.
Tap it. Just do it. You're braver than you think. Seriously, don't be scared.
Scroll. Keep scrolling. It's like searching for that one sock that always goes missing.
Eventually, you’ll find "Settings." It's usually lurking somewhere near the bottom.
Now, brace yourself. You're about to enter the Settings Zone.
Look for something language-related. It might say "Language," or maybe even be cunningly disguised as "Country & Language." Amazon loves a good riddle.
Found it? Click it. Feel the power surging through you!
Choosing Your Mother Tongue (or Any Tongue You Prefer)
A list of languages should appear. It's like a global buffet for your eyeballs.
Scan the list. Look for your native tongue. Or maybe you're feeling adventurous and want to practice your high school Spanish. Go for it!
Tap the language of your choice. Boom! Instant linguistic transformation.
The app should refresh. Everything should now be in a language you (hopefully) understand.
